红帽张先民:企业Linux 7技术亮点是容器技术

http://www.linuxdiyf.com/viewarticle.php?id=416784


  在6月12日红帽公司发布重新定义企业操作系统的红帽企业Linux 7之后,比特网记者第一时间采访到红帽大中华区总裁张先民博士,请他为中国的用户解读一下开源技术的最新发展和创新动向,以及为什么说企业Linux 7重新定义了企业操作系统。

  “目前是开源开放的时代,是一个后IOE的时代。”张先民博士说,全球调查数据显示,Linux已经成为趋势。2013年,全球操作系统中55%是 Windows,25%是收费Linux,19%是免费Linux,1%是Unix系统。至2017年,Windows占有率预计将从55%降至 41%,Linux则上升至58%,其中收费Linux占30%,免费Linux占24%。也就是说未来基本只有Windows和Linux两个操作系 统,Linux的成长速度将是Windows的三倍。

  而相比于致力于支持不同环境的红帽企业Linux 6版本,新推出的红帽企业Linux 7做了很大的改进,变成了一个开放混合云的基础。其中,Linux 7最核心的技术叫做容器技术。“容器技术能够更轻量地提供在云计算环境的一个分装包,适合开放混合云;企业Linux 7在管理上也有很多改进,能提供智能便捷的性能调整、创新的管理系统、集中的管理接口等。整体来讲,红帽企业Linux 7是一个跨时代的、有很多集成、很多优势技术的产品发布,最重要的是适合开放混合云环境。”

  开放创新引领未来发展

  谈到目前的IT大趋势,有着30年IT从业经验的张博士的最大体会是,“IT正处于大洗牌的过程中。目前,很多大的IT公司都在进行非常大的变革。同时,市场形势也让人眼花缭乱,比如去IOE、中国政府禁止使用Windows8等等。”

  “然而趋势的前瞻,是Open Source(开源)所带领的开放创新将引领发展。”目前最热门的话题是BAT,即互联网颠覆传统产业。BAT大部分都用Open Source(开源), Open Source(开源)引领的创新已经超越过去几十年Microsoft、Oracle、IBM、SAP所引领的专有软件的创新。

  “云计算近两年非常流行,有云操作系统之称的是OpenStack;讲大数据、Hadoop百分之百也是Open Source。另外,目前虚拟化已经从桌面移到了Storage跟network,关于Storge虚拟化和network虚拟化基本上都是Open Sourc技术。从这点看,可以说最近一两年,开放创新已经在引领发展。”

  “现在越来越多的思路跟传统思路不大一样,大部分是一个很小的PC服务器在跑,而不像以前买一个大的IBM主机或者大的Unix系统,所以说这种情况 下需要大量的服务器。在美国有一个公司叫OCP,他们基本上设计一个机柜把风扇全部拿走节能,中国的天蝎计划是BAT引领的。大部分互联网巨头们,包括谷 歌、Amazon、Facebook、中国的BAT都是用Open Source。所以现在一想到创新技术,IT的管理者首先会想到Open Source。”

  红帽专攻五大技术

  面对新的市场形势和应用需求,张博士透露,红帽公司最近主要专攻五大技术。“第一个是云技术。目前讲云的时候,主要是讲IaaS和PaaS。IaaS 里面最热门的主题是云操作系统,Cloud OS目前最热门的话题是OpenStack,而红帽是最主要的创建者和贡献者。红帽在PaaS领域的产品OpenShift,也处在领先地位。红帽在过去 两年买了两家做Open Source Stroage的公司。关于操作系统,Unix已慢慢消亡,Linux逐渐成长起来。另外,红帽虚拟化技术也在不断成长壮大。所以说,红帽这五大技术都处 于市场领先地位。”

  目前是开放混合云的时代,新发布的红帽企业Linux 7加了很多的创新,可以从私有云和公有云之间无缝的转移的过程。其中,最重要的技术就是容器技术。

  那么,容器技术是如何发展而来的呢?张博士介绍,以前的IT系统是买一台机器上面装了操作系统和软件,运行一个应用。一个服务器可以运行ABC三个应 用,但很少三个应用能一起来运行的。一般来讲,一个机器运行一个应用,为什么?因为不同的应用会互相影响。一般来讲,一台物理机运行一个应用,相当浪费, 很多机器只用了5%的CPU使用率。大概发展到六七年前的时候,虚拟化技术开始启用。操作系统加一个虚拟化的Hypervisor,可以跑多个应用,这种 虚拟化技术增加了机器的使用率。

  “现在,红帽企业Linux 7借助独有的容器技术,可以在混合云环境中更好的适用。目前,从虚拟化技术移到了一个容器技术,不一样的地方在于到目前为止大部分机器有一个 Hypervisor,每一个Hypervisor上跑一个Guest OS。当每一个应用需要用I/O的时候,都要通过Hypervisor,互相抢Hypervisor,互相抢I/O的功能,也造成I/O的瓶颈,而容器技 术把这一些操作系统方面共同的东西抽取出来整合打包在一起,形成一个集装箱,它可以在物理机上跑,也可以在虚拟机上跑。”

  容器技术到底好在哪里呢?“每个应用就是一个应用的集装箱,包括应用本身以及所依赖运行环境全部合在一起,包括一些操作系统所需要的内核,相同的运行环境进行标准化全部跑在一起,这样完全发挥物理机的性能,适合各种的应用。”

  “这个变化过程就好比从散装货船到集装箱的过程。”以前海运多用散装货,如果想要搬家,大概十几二十个箱子,而且各个箱子尺寸也都不一样。因此,卡车 来载的时候,散装货轮使用率相当低。为什么?因为每一个箱子尺寸大小不一样,排来排去有很多浪费的空间。之后,诞生了尺寸标准化的集装箱,效率就非常高。 容器技术就相当于标准化的集装箱,它把所有的东西规格化,每个应用,大概相同的操作系统,一些共同的需要东西全部摆在一起,每一个应用都放在一个容器里面 运行。因此,容器技术能快速的运行。拿春运高峰的订票系统的运行来开,如果运用了容器技术,就能很明确的知道需要在公有云中用多少个标准量的服务器。

  最后,张博士用一句话来总结为什么Open Source现在能形成这么好的一个势头,他说,中国有一句话叫众人拾柴火焰高。OpenStack突然会变成下一代云操作系统的标准,每一个厂商都有上 百个优秀技术人员投身OpenStack的开发,就好像每一个人丢一根火柴进去火焰就燃起来了。目前在中国,华为、中兴都有上百个创作者来创建 OpenStack,所以OpenStack不成功也难。当然,这也是为什么说IT开放创新能够引领发展的原因。

  来源:比特网
<script>window._bd_share_config={"common":{"bdSnsKey":{},"bdText":"","bdMini":"2","bdMiniList":false,"bdPic":"","bdStyle":"0","bdSize":"16"},"share":{}};with(document)0[(getElementsByTagName('head')[0]||body).appendChild(createElement('script')).src='http://bdimg.share.baidu.com/static/api/js/share.js?v=89860593.js?cdnversion='+~(-new Date()/36e5)];</script>
阅读(610) | 评论(0) | 转发(1) |
0

上一篇:Hadoop

下一篇:某中校长的开学致辞

给主人留下些什么吧!~~
评论热议
posted @ 2016-02-01 00:00  张同光  阅读(92)  评论(0编辑  收藏  举报